What happens when you heat acetone?

“Solvents like acetone evaporate faster when heated making them more flammable. Adding heat makes acetone work faster, but you have to be more careful to avoid accidental fires,” says Doug Schoon, CND’s Chief Scientific Officer.

How do you remove gel nails with acetone and hot water?

Fill a large shallow bowl with 1 inch of hot water Water. Place the small bowl in the large bowl. This slightly heats the acetone, which speeds up the removal process. Cover the skin around your nails and cuticles with petroleum jelly.

Does acetone melt plastic shells?

There are all kinds of plastics. If a particular plastic is very similar to acetone, the acetone will dissolve or at least attack its surface, soften, smudge, or even dissolve the plastic. Other plastics, unlike acetone, are unaffected by the solvent.

How do you use acetone at home?

Pour 100% acetone into a bowl or bowl and soak your nails in it it for five minutes. Using a metal cuticle pusher, gently push the polish off your nails by pushing down from your cuticles. Dip your nails again for five minutes, then gently press again. Repeat this until your acrylics are completely softened.

Can you pour acetone in the sink?

The short answer is no, and for very good reasons. Since acetone is a strong solvent, it might seem logical to use it to unclog a drain or drain and it would be an easy way to get rid of your acetone waste. Although it will likely dissolve anything clogging your drain, it probably won’t stop there.

How do you remove gel nails with hot water?

Soak your nails in warm water or simply start the process after a hot shower. While your nails are still wet, use a cuticle stick to push back the polish near a broken edge. It should be easy to pull them off at this point. Peel off as much as you can, and if any bits are stubborn, file them off.

With what do you soak nails in acetone?

Soak a cotton ball in acetone nail polish remover, place the cotton ball on and around your nail, and then wrap the nail with a piece of aluminum foil. Step #5: Repeat. Continue soaking acetone cotton balls with aluminum foil and wrapping them around your nails.
